Description

Huawei's Camera & Computer Vision Lab in Zurich is seeking a Research Scientist to pioneer AI-Driven Optics, moving beyond incremental improvements to solve the complex inverse problems of lens design, optimizing for both extreme image quality and high-volume manufacturing viability.

Responsibilities

  • Neural Inverse Design: Develop AI frameworks to automate the design of complex, multi-element aspherical lens systems.
  • End-to-End Co-Design: Lead the integrated optimization of optical hardware and downstream AI restoration algorithms.
  • Intelligent Manufacturing (DfM): Leverage generative AI and Bayesian optimization to simulate manufacturing variances.
  • Next-Gen Simulations: Research and implement differentiable ray-tracing or wave-optics solvers.
  • Academic Leadership: Publish original research in top-tier venues and contribute to Huawei’s global patent portfolio.
